3 Ways to Disable Chrome from Auto-updating in Windows 10

WebWay 1: Stop chrome from updating by disabling Google update service Step 1: Right click on Start button, select Computer Manager. Step 2: In the left sidebar, expand System Tools Task Scheduler Task Scheduler Library. Find out two schedulers of Google update as the image below, right-click and Disable it. Tap the app you wish to change auto-update … WebNov 2, 2016 · All it takes is one command on the Terminal, and Chrome automatic updates will get disabled on a Mac. If you’re sure that you want to disable automatic updates for Google Chrome on your Mac, just launch Terminal, and type the command “ defaults write com.google.Keystone.Agent checkInterval 0 “. Setting the checkInterval to 0 basically ...

WebOpen the Run command by pressing Windows + R on your keyboard.Here, type “services.msc” and click on “OK”. This will open the Windows Services window. From the list of services that you see, double click on “Windows Update”. You should now see its properties window pop-up.
